Serco is hiring a Customer Service Assistant at NorthLink Ferries in Stromness, Orkney. This part-time position involves delivering excellent customer service by supporting bookings and inquiries. You will help ensure smooth operations at the ferry terminal while working in a supportive team environment.
The role offers 21 hours per week on a fixed-term contract and comes with a salary of Β£16,969.68 plus benefits like:
- 25 days annual leave
- A pension scheme
- Various employee assistance programs
